// Reconnect backoff ceiling for the Pylon feed socket.
// Bug: the old 2s cap caused thundering-herd reconnects after a
// broker restart — every client hammered the gateway simultaneously.
// 30s ceiling plus jitter (see backoff.go) spreads the load.
// Do not lower without checking gateway connection-rate alarms.
// Fix landed and was confirmed against the build listed below.

trace token, fafog-kageg: htk4_98e6

### Load testing the checkout flow

Before merging changes to the Pinwheel checkout service, run the standard load profile against staging — 500 virtual shoppers, 10-minute ramp. Watch the cart-commit latency; anything over 800ms at p95 means back to the drawing board. Don't point the load rig at prod, we've all heard that story. Setup steps and the latest baseline numbers are on the internal page here.

operations page: https://confluence.norvacorp.corp/spaces/dash/dash/a5a4e1c207d6

The Orvane Labs bike cage and the east and west parking gates operate on separate access schedules, and facilities desk staff should note that visitor vehicles may only use the west gate between 07:00 and 19:00. Cyclists requesting cage access must show a valid day pass, and their details should be entered in the access ledger before the cage is opened. Gates must never be propped open, even briefly, during deliveries. When a manual override is required at either gate, use the code below.

staff pass of fadup-fawig = bdg-FUNKS-4

TURN-208: Gatevale turnstile counters at the Merrow Field pilot double-count when a rotation reverses mid-cycle. Attendance totals drift roughly 2% high per event. The debounce window fix is implemented, reviewed by Ilsa, and soak-tested across two simulated match days without drift. Ready for your cut; the candidate build is identified below.

trace token, tagag-tafog: htk6_5ed18c